在Kubernetes集群當中,我們可以通過配置liveness probe(存活探針)和readiness probe(可讀性探針)來影響容器的生存周期。參考文檔:https://kubernetes.io/docs/tasks/configure-pod ...
探針 就緒探測 存活探測 探針是由kubelet對容器執行的定期診斷,要執行診斷,kubelet調用由容器實現的Handler,有三種類型的處理程序: ExecActive:在容器內執行指定命令,若命令退出時返回碼為 ,則認為診斷成功 TCPSockeAction:對指定端口上的容器的ip地址進行tcp檢查,如果端口打開,則診斷為成功 HTTPGetAction:對指定端口和路徑上的容器ip地址執 ...
2020-06-08 22:17 0 934 推薦指數:
在Kubernetes集群當中,我們可以通過配置liveness probe(存活探針)和readiness probe(可讀性探針)來影響容器的生存周期。參考文檔:https://kubernetes.io/docs/tasks/configure-pod ...
在設計關鍵任務、高可用應用程序時,彈性是要考慮的最重要因素之一。 當應用程序可以快速從故障中恢復時,它便具有彈性。 雲原生應用程序通常設計為使用微服務架構,其中每個組件都位於容器中。為了確保Kubernetes托管的應用程序高可用,在設計集群時需要遵循一些特定的模式,其中有“健康探測模式 ...
目錄 kubernetes之pod健康檢查 1、概述和分類 2、LivenessProbe探針(存活性探測) 3、ReadinessProbe探針(就緒型探測) 4、探針的實現方式 4.1、ExecAction ...
參考文檔: https://jimmysong.io/kubernetes-handbook/guide/configure-liveness-readiness-probes.html 一、Pod的liveness和readiness探針 當你使用kuberentes的時候,有沒有遇到過 ...
1.存活探針 使用Kubernetes的一個主要好處是,可以給Kubernetes—個容器列表來由其保持容器在集群中的運行。可以通過讓Kubernetes創建pod資源,為其選擇一個工作節點並在該節點上運行該pod的容器來完成此操作。但是,如果其中一個容器終止,或一個pod的所有容器都終止 ...
類型: livenessProbe:如果檢查失敗,將殺死容器,根據Pod的restartPolicy來操作。 r ...
文章目錄 服務探針與回調hook(健康檢查) 一、存活性探針(LivenessProbe) 1、存活型檢查基本用法 2、存活性探針三種使用方式 ...
目錄 1、何為健康檢查 2、探針分類 2.1、LivenessProbe探針(存活性探測) 2.2、ReadinessProbe探針(就緒型探測) 3、探針實現方法 3.1、Container Exec 3.2 ...